dead pixel doesn't means it's muse be black color, (if it's black without emitting light/RGB-color, then it's probably just a dust)
I've dead pixel in my laptop and the color is Reddish-Blue when displaying white scene on monitor.
The pixel contain 3 color (Red, Green, Blue), so in my case should be the Green-subpixel is died.
In your case (Yellowish tinge), probably because the Blue-subpixel is dead.
because Yellow color is produced by combining Red & Green color only (without Blue)
White color is produced by combining Red-Green-Blue subpixel all together, so you must test your screen under white scene (eg: in browser, white text editor, or program can detect dead pixel on the android market)
